This program creates a national digital resource of historically significant newspapers published between 1690 and 1963 from all states and U.S. jurisdictions. The Library of Congress (LOC) maintains this freely accessible, searchable online database.

Because evaluating behavior change in a target population is a more sophisticated activity than simply counting the number of people who showed up for a workshop, the inclusion of behavior change indicators may imply that you are dealing with a research study. You plan to write up your results and publish them in peer-reviewed journals.
